Mayamam Weavers
Located across from Scholl Orchards
|
Beginning in 2008 as a cooperative of women in Cajolá, a Mayan town in the western highlands of Guatemala, the women of the town came together to explore ways to provide jobs within their community, rather than migrate to the U.S. and separate their families. Since then, then cooperative has grown to 20 weavers and seamstresses, all earning fair trade wages while learning the skills to run a business. As proud members of the Fair Trade Association, their products range from beautiful woven homegoods, aprons, bags, toiletry cases belts and so much more!

Cabbage Throw Farm
Claytonia is back
|
It's the season to celebrate all the roots of winter and this weekend, Cabbage Throw Farm is featuring one of their favorite winter greens, claytonia. Claytonia is a cold hearty green also known as Miner’s Lettuce which has wild and fresh leaves. These leaves can be found in a winter mix of lettuce and spinach. Other greens available include baby kale, spring mix, frisée, escarole, chard and mustard greens. Additional produce includes carrots, beets, kohlrabi, turnips, rutabaga, specialty radishes, winter squash, yellow onions, garlic, and Comeback Farm’s potatoes and sweet potatoes.

Scholl's GoldRush have been kept in cold storage just long enough for their flavor to be fully developed. And now they're ready!
Fruit Facts: The Gold Rush apple is derived from Golden Delicious as the seed parent, with crosses from several other varieties including Winesap, Melrose, and Rome Beauty. The mildly sweet flavor and crispness of the Gold Rush's flesh make this apple good for fresh eating and cooking, as well as juice and cider.

Raspberry Ridge Sheep Creamery
|
Rob will feature a variety of nutritiously rich sheep cheeses this Saturday. Did you know that sheep dairy products are super healthy and easier to digest than cow's milk? The lactose is a smaller molecule so it breaks down more readily. Also sheep milk has the "A2" protein which is shown to be increasingly helpful in digestion. And because Raspberry Ridge's sheep are pasture raised, their milk is high in omega 3's which is good for circulation.
This week Rob will have blue cheese, manchego, Rose's Ridge, spreadables, gouda, feta and halloumi. Stop by and select a variety of sheep cheeses for a holiday cheese platter!
